Abstract

Adiabatic time dependent Hartree-Fock theory is applied to describe the excitation of giant resonances in heavy ion collisions. Equations similar to, but more general than those of Broglia, Dasso and Winther are derived. The excitation of the giant quadrupole mode is found to be too weak to explain the structures observed in calcium-calcium collisions at 400 MeV.
